  1. Frustration
    Poet: Julie Hebert, © 2011

    In life there are,
    So many frustrations.
    It all depends,
    On how we approach them.

    There are times,
    I could sit down and cry.
    But then I realize,
    That's a waste of my time.

    My time is better spent,
    Fixing the problem.
    Crying would only,
    Land me at the bottom.

    So get on up,
    And hold your head high.
    It's time for you too,
    Let your frustration slide by.

  3. Don't Give In
    by Catherine Pulsifer


    Though you feel like giving in
    And surrender to despair
    When temptation is to quit
    The challenge isn’t too fair.

    Take a break, think again
    Don’t let the hope slip away
    For when frustration sets in
    There could be yet another way.

    Don’t label it as a defeat
    Remember previous successes so sweet
    Push forward, trying something new
    Take courage, try again with a different view.

  5. Feeling Frustration
    Poet: Unknown


    Today before you think of saying an unkind word–
    think of someone who can’t speak.

    Before you complain about the taste of your food–
    think of someone who has nothing to eat.

    Before you complain about your husband or wife–
    think of someone who is crying out to God for a companion.

    Today before you complain about life–
    think of someone who went too early to heaven.

    Before you complain about your children–
    think of someone who desires children but they’re barren.

    Before you argue about your dirty house, someone didn’t clean or sweep–
    think of the people who are living in the streets.

    Before whining about the distance you drive–
    think of someone who walks the same distance with their feet.

    And when you are tired and complain about your job–
    think of the unemployed, the disabled and those who wished they had your job.

    But before you think of pointing the finger or condemning another–
    remember that not one of us are without sin and we all answer to one maker.

    And when depressing thoughts seem to get you down–
    put a smile on your face and thank God you’re alive and still around.

    Life is a gift –
    Live it, Enjoy it, Celebrate it, and Fulfill it.

  7. Don't Be Frustrated
    by Catherine Pulsifer


    A task put aside today is a future in dismay.
    A much bigger burden once procrastination plays;
    The abruptness of time, no escape or reprieve,
    Success is denied by leaving it, rather than achieve.

    Resulting in frustrations; a tragedy plain to see,
    For yesterday's work is not leaving tomorrow free.
    Don't be frustrated by things not being done
    Do it today so that tomorrow you don't run.

  9. We All Feel It
    by Catherine Pulsifer, © 2020


    In life, we all feel it
    The times when we have to bite our lip
    We feel like throwing up our hands
    Or digging in our heels and taking a stand.

    Frustration is the feeling that I'm talking about
    The times we feel annoyed or put out.
    We can stay frustrated and let the stress mount
    Or we can stop and to ten we count.

    We may not be able to change what has happened
    But we don't need to feel like we are flattened
    Take a breath and stand back
    Take a moment to relax.

    Sometimes it is best to walk away
    And come back to it another day.
    The frustrating  feeling can be changed
    It is our attitude that we must rearrange.

    So next time you have that feeling creep up
    Don't give in and don't give up
    You may have to do it another way
    But realize that is okay.

    Life is too short to stay annoyed
    If you do your health you destroy
    You can overcome frustration
    By building your thoughts on a positive foundation.

  11. Frustration Setting In?
    by Catherine Pulsifer, © 2021


    How do you feel when you can't achieve
    helping others to be all they can be?
    How do you feel when others won't listen
    Even when the facts are a given?

    Do you feel frustration setting in
    And your patience wearing thin?
    What do you do to keep from being blue?
    Do you feel like giving up and saying, "I'm through!"

    There are many things in life that we can't control.
    Keeping our attitude positive should be our goal.
    Don't let others discourage and frustrate you
    Keep moving forward with what you know is true.

    The emotion of frustration
    Is how you react to a situation.
    Try to see another's point of view
    You can try to present ideas in a way that is new.

    Frustration can only cause you stress
    It will take away from any progress.
    So let the emotion go
    And keep moving forward no matter how slow.
